Summary Absa Bank Kenya has officially launched the Absa Kenya Foundation (AKF) as a social arm that will accelerate its positive impact and sustainability commitments within the community. The Foundation, which will be sponsored by the Bank and its strategic partners, will focus on four key programmatic pillars: entrepreneurship, education and skills, natural resource management, and health and humanitarian relief. Absa Bank Kenya will contribute 1.5% of its annual earnings to the new Foundation, starting off with KES500 million as seed funding towards transformative projects that will be implemented through strategic partnerships to address major societal and environmental issues. Blockchain technology is reshaping the global payments landscape, offering innovative solutions to persistent issues, particularly in Africa. This transformation is crucial for the continent, where traditional financial systems are often inefficient and costly, especially in cross-border transactions and remittances. Africa’s payment infrastructure relies heavily on outdated systems, many of which have been in place for over 50 years. These traditional systems depend on multiple intermediaries, such as banks, card networks, and payment processors. Each intermediary adds layers of complexity, driving up costs and causing delays. Mastercard and Amazon Payment Services have signed a multi-year commercial partnership agreement to digitize payment acceptance in Middle East and Africa, across countries including Bahrain, Egypt, Jordan, Kuwait, Lebanon, Oman, Qatar, South Africa and UAE. As part of the collaboration, the leading payment service provider (PSP) will adopt Mastercard Gateway – a single touchpoint for payment processing – as a payment solution available in 40 markets in the region. The integration of the solution will enable merchants to offer fast, seamless, and secure transactions as well as convenient payment choices to customers. LG Electronics has announced the winners of its webOS TV platform hackathon, which took place at the LG webOS Summit last week. The event was geared toward AI-based solutions and gaming services, and sought ideas to enhance the gaming category on the Smart TV. Developers from around the world applied for the opportunity to present their ideas for apps and services to be used on webOS-based LG Smart TVs in millions of homes, with the goal of diversifying and improving the gaming experience on the LG TVs powered by webOS.
